Beartbreaking details in the death of Anne Burrell have been shared by People, who obtained a report from the New York Police Department.
According to the report, the NYPD confirmed that there was a âsuicidal noteâ left behind in the primary bedroom of Burrellâs home in Brooklyn. The report stated that the note was found by an investigator after her death on June 17, 2025.
Heartbreaking Note & Journal Entries Found in Anne Burrellâs Home

According to the police report, the investigator also discovered âsuicidalâ journal entries on a bed in the same room where the note was found.
The report noted that in the early morning hours of the day Burrell died, a redacted individual âmarried to Anneâ had ânoticed that the bed was made in their room which is not normal.â At the time of her death, the Food Network chef was married to Stuart Claxton, whom she met on the Bumble dating app in 2018, People reported.
According to the police report, Claxton found Burrell on the bathroom floor âwith a bunch of over-the-counter pills on the floor.â When he made an attempt to wake her up by âshaking her and slapping her face,â he was unable to bring her back to consciousness and immediately called 911.
Claxton told police that his wife had ânever attempted suicide in the pastâ and ânever talked about it,â per the NYPD report. He also stated that Burrell hadnât shown âany signs that she would do something like this.â
Five weeks after she died, Burrellâs cause of death was ruled a suicide from âacute intoxication due to the combined effects of diphenhydramine, ethanol, cetirizine, and amphetamine,â and was determined by the New York City Medical Examinerâs Office, TMZ reported.
